“If someone has difficulty sleeping because of various sounds, whether those environmental sounds are constant or sporadic, then a white noise machine may help to smooth out that noise,” explains Dr. Michael Gradisar, head of sleep science at Sleep Cycle, a sleep tracking app. In addition to helping with sleep, a white noise machine can also be used to drown out distracting noise while working on trying to concentrate.

How we picked the best white noise machines
Beyond just playing white noise, sleep experts say there are a few other specifications you should look for when shopping.
- Volume control: The experts we spoke with agreed that a volume knob is an important component to look for. “The World Health Organization (WHO) recommends that environmental noise should be below 40 dB between 11 p.m. and 7 a.m.,” says Gradisar. “Sleep science shows that if sounds are loud, but not loud enough to wake you up, they may affect your deep sleep during the night.” All the options on our list can control the volume or play white noise at under 40 dB.
- Bonus features: In addition to playing white noise, many machines also have additional functions that can be helpful for sleep — like the ability to play other soothing sounds, a clock or a light that gently turns on to mimic sunrise to wake you.
